Video surgery (endovideosurgery) sounds futuristic, but it already exists today and is a set of minimally invasive medical procedures. Using thin fiber-optic instruments connected to digital cameras through small incisions, doctors can see what is happening inside the body on a television monitor. Video equipment can be used for diagnostic purposes to examine individual organs, as well as to perform full-fledged operations using specially designed surgical instruments.
The range of diseases to which endovideosurgical and video-assisted techniques can be applied is quite wide. These include cholelithiasis (acute and chronic cholecystitis), acute and chronic appendicitis, hernias of the esophageal orifice of the diaphragm, external abdominal hernias, tumor diseases of the adrenal glands (including the so-called adrenal incidentalomas), some diseases of the thymus gland and mediastinal organs.
Video surgery technologies are constantly being improved and expanded. The decision to use video surgical methods instead of traditional "open" surgical approaches should be made on an individual basis and only after the patient and the doctor have analyzed all the risks and benefits.
There are a number of general advantages of video surgical technology over traditional:
• Diagnostic technologies as of today. Although radiation and ultrasound machines can detect organic changes or tumors in the body, using a videoscope allows the doctor to directly see the affected organ and obtain a tissue sample using special instruments. In some cases, the cause of the disease can be identified and removed as part of the diagnostic procedure itself.
• Small incisions are the best cosmetic effect. Incisions left "open" by surgery can range from 20 to 30 cm in length (sometimes more). In video surgery, there can be from one to five small incisions (depending on the procedure), each of which will be from 0.5 to 2.5 cm in length.
• "Extended view" for the operational team. Modern endoscopes can increase the area of the visible area from two to seven times. This provides the surgeon with great detail, etc.
K. The image is projected onto a monitor and the entire surgical team sees what is happening.
• Rapid recovery, reduction of hospitalization and disability, reduction of the need for medicines. During video surgery, the doctor should not make large incisions in muscles and tissues. This reduces postoperative pain and makes recovery time much shorter. For example, with an "open" gallbladder removal, the patient usually faces a 5-8-day hospital stay and cannot return to normal activity for 4-6 weeks.
